AGENCY: Salt Lake City (Utah). Police Department

SERIES: 7377
TITLE: Data management information systems activity report
DATES: 1977-
ARRANGEMENT: Chronological

DESCRIPTION: This monthly computer printout contains information on crime and police performance for various areas and management structures. This report includes the type of offense by day of week and two hour time period; case clearance summary; recovered vehicles; type of police activity; time of officer involvement; and stolen, recovered, damaged property by type and value.

FORMAT MANAGEMENT

Paper: Retain in Office for 10 years and then microfilm and destroy provided microfilm has passed inspection.

Microfilm master: Retain in Office for 80 years and then transfer to State Archives.

Computer magnetic storage media: Retain in Agency Record Center for 90 years and then erase.

APPRAISAL

Administrative

Administratively, these reports are critical to the analysis of criminal activity in Salt Lake City and need to be kept for 90 years. Historically, they provide important information on crime in Salt Lake City.
